We begin your service with an initial “deep cleaning” of your home. This first cleaning is similar to a “catch up” clean or a spring clean. There is a variety of first time tasks performed during this clean that requires extra time and effort. There is a big difference between “old” dirt and “new” dirt. If we don’t get rid of it the first time, keeping your home truly spotless will not be possible. Deep cleaning would usually take two to four times longer than regular cleanings.
